What’s New in the Canon EOS R6 Mark III?
Canon adds a 32-megapixel sensor and 7K video to deliver a sharper jump from the previous 24MP model. The redesigned dual-card system, faster processing, and Canon Log 2 support boost flexibility for pro workflows. With open-gate support, creators get extra room for cropping in post — ideal for cinematic content.
Does the EOS R6 Mark III Shoot 7K Video?
Yes — Canon adds a 32-megapixel sensor and 7K video performance capable of 7K/60p RAW and 4K/120p. The new tally lamp makes it easier to confirm active recording, and the full-size HDMI replaces Micro HDMI for sturdier rig builds. Together, these upgrades make the R6 Mark III more reliable for filmmakers and livestream creators.
How Does Autofocus Improve on the R6 Mark III?
Canon adds a 32-megapixel sensor and 7K video but also dramatically upgrades autofocus. You can now register specific faces so the camera prioritizes them during continuous tracking — useful for events, interviews, and weddings. Overall tracking remains fast and accurate thanks to Canon’s latest AF algorithms.
Is the EOS R6 Mark III Worth It?
Canon adds a 32-megapixel sensor and 7K video to provide pro-level specs at a price starting at $2,799 (body-only). Optional kits with the RF 24-105mm STM or RF 24-105mm L lenses start at $3,149 and $4,049. For photographers who don’t need 45MP from the R5 series — but still want serious video — this is a strong value.
